Peptides: Clinical Relevance and Basics

Peptides represent short chains of amino acids linked by peptide bonds, forming the building blocks of protein molecules. They are vital in cellular signaling, including skin regeneration, immune system activity, and metabolic processes. In clinical practice, peptidesciences are frequently cited for their role in supporting skin health by means of stimulation of collagen production and modulation of skin barrier functions.

The science behind peptides in skincare relies on their ability to imitate natural protein fragments, which can influence the cell’s proliferative and reparative behaviors. Important Clinical Buying Factors for Peptides

Quality and Manufacturing

Foremost among considerations in peptide purchasing is the significance of production quality. Peptide synthesis demands precise chemical methods to achieve purity and proper folding of the peptide sequence. Inconsistent methods in manufacturing may cause variation in peptide stability and biological activity.

In clinical settings, peptides supplied in vials ought to come from trusted sources to reduce contamination risks or breakdown derivatives. Clinical Evaluation of Skincare Peptide Products

Peptides have become popular ingredients in skincare products, with a range of peptide-based serums and creams targeting skin rejuvenation and anti-aging effects. Clinical perspectives gained from peptidesciences reveal their effect on physiological repair functions.

How Peptides Work in the Skin

Peptides incorporated in skincare products are typically designed to penetrate the skin barrier and prompt skin cells to synthesize collagen as well as additional matrix proteins. The result is firmer skin and fewer visible wrinkles.

It has been observed in practice that peptide content and stability in products can vary greatly. The use of antibody-based assays in laboratory research assists in confirming how peptides impact skin cells, facilitating continued scientific progress for optimal product composition.

Product Selection and Safety

In the clinical context, the selection of skincare products containing peptides requires attention to formulation stability and the source of peptides. Any product listing peptides should be vetted for clarity in manufacturing standards. Degradation risk in peptide blends calls for correct storage and handling of vials.

Special attention should be paid to patient skin reactivity, as peptides can induce allergies in some cases. Monitoring skin reactions during product use should be routine to maximize product safety in clinical use.

GHRP and Related Peptides in Clinical Observation

Growth Hormone Releasing Peptides (GHRPs) have attracted interest in clinical research due to their role in stimulating growth hormone secretion. GHRP peptides, commonly procured in vial form, are widely used for research and lab tests.

Clinical observations suggest that GHRPs are handled within tightly controlled research protocols due to their biologically active nature. The procurement of GHRP peptides should be approached with attention to manufacturing consistency and documentation of assay results to support reproducibility.

Compliance and Legal Aspects

It is important to note that many peptides remain classified for research only use and should not be used clinically without appropriate regulatory approval. Observations in clinical practice emphasize adherence to legal frameworks when purchasing and using peptides for investigational purposes.

It’s essential for clinical and research teams to keep documentation outlining the intended product use and make sure all processes align with governing policies, remembering that supplier claims do not replace regulatory oversight.
